
In the 11th round match of the English Premier League, "Arsenal" faced "Sunderland" away. The game ended with a 2:2 score.
The visitors controlled the game, but due to goalkeeper David Raya's mistake, they were deprived of victory in the final moments. At the start of the match, the hosts played cautiously but converted their first chance into a goal.
In the 36th minute, defender Ballard headed the ball into the net from a free kick, putting "Sunderland" ahead. "Arsenal" increased their attacks but couldn't break past the hosts' goalkeeper in the first half.
Rice and Saka created several attacking opportunities, but precision was lacking in their shots. In the second half, Mikel Arteta's team increased the tempo of the game.
In the 54th minute, Saka equalized with a powerful strike. After that, Trossard moved in from the flank and delivered a precise shot into the corner in the 72nd minute, putting the "Gunners" in the lead.
The visitors came close to scoring a third goal, but Merino and Rice missed their chances. Towards the end of the match, the hosts increased their pressure.
Raya managed to save his team from inevitable goals several times but made a mistake in a decisive situation. In the 90th minute, Brobbey dominated an aerial duel and sent the ball into the net with an acrobatic shot.
After the referee reviewed the situation via VAR, the goal was confirmed.
